    Default Leech Study

    Ok, so i'm sure many of you are thinking "really, do we need a leech study?" Well, i thought so and didn't see anything on the forums about it (sorry if there was one of these that i missed already) so i decided to do it. Well, the description doesn't specifically state that the damage done to the opponent is the amount of health you receive (yes it is implied), and since transference doesn't work that way, i figured i would check it out.

    So i went to SY5 and used it on one of those ops that heals a bunch of times. the damage of leech ranged from 26-39, and i always got the same amount of health that i damaged the enemy for. I decided to throw decay in there and see how that affected the damage. now the damage was 29-43, and i got the same amount of health back once again.

    Well, that's it. i had custom plasmatech with a whistler equipped, not that it matters really for the purposes i did this for. i was planning on trying this on different enemies, but didn't feel the need to.

    Suspicion confirmed.
